Bright straw, thin stream of endless bubbles. A bit smoky and closed at first, but as the wine warmed, an oily richness of fresh coconut macaroons, vanilla bean and challah emerged. The palate followed the nose, closed at first and then it exploded into a rich and full-bodied palate with notes of profiterole, black-cap raspberry, white truffles, citrus rind, sweet tea and caramel brulee, with a long, enveloping finish. Medium acid, rich mousse, almost a hints of tannins (elevage in used Sauternes barrrels!!!!!) Wonderful Blanc de Noirs, highly recommended.
